• Day 54 - Sestao to Pobena

    14–15 juni 2024, Spanien ⋅ ⛅ 21 °C

    We awoke early ready to escape our urban nightmare. We were more chilled and had our planned breakfast of yoghurt, strawberries, coffee and croissants- while keeping an eye on the toilet situation!!
    We escaped before 9 and hit the urban highway.
    We passed over Bilbao’s equivalent of spaghetti junction with a 2km bridge spanning motorways and railways.
    Then we hit a great network of cycle and walking paths with no cars. Initially first 3km along a motorway then we veered off into countryside. So went 15km with no cars to contend with - very impressive.
    We met a cycle class of youngsters out with their teachers - what a great facility to have on your doorstep.
    On the whole the sun was out until we neared the end of the walk in La Arena, then the sun went in and the wind increased.
    We came across the sea at La Arena and stopped for lunch. Simon was very excited to discover egg, bacon and chips on the menu.
    It was like being in Cornwall with the Atlantic rushing in and surfers in the sea, waiting for a ride.
    We headed across long boardwalks over sand and scrublands to the lovely village of Pobeña.
    Here we found our lovely room for the evening which was such a contrast to the last couple of days 💕😇
    The weather closed in and we had heavy showers for a couple of hours with horizon covered in mist.
    As it dried up we ventured out to find some evening food and were entertained by the local basque folk group. A fitting end to a lovely day.
